Summary: duplicate json key "echoParams" should be removed in
ping-response

Apparently the /admin/ping handler will duplicate the echoParams key in the
json-response.
$ curl -s http://localhost:8983/solr/test-node-client/admin/ping?wt=json
{"responseHeader":{"status":0,"QTime":2,"params":{"df":"text","echoParams":"all","rows":"10","echoParams":"all","wt":"json","q":"solrpingquery","distrib":"false"}},"status":"OK"}
Having "echoParams":"all" twice in that response doesn't really make sense?
Strictly speaking this is allowed in the json spec, so it is not a violation in
principle
http://stackoverflow.com/questions/21832701/does-json-syntax-allow-duplicate-keys-in-an-object
However there are some json-parse implementations out there that want to map
this into hashtables and are not silently overwriting the key with the last
seen value, but are throwing errors in the process.
To those a cleanup of the json response would make life somewhat easier.
